Nobody looks forward to cleaning their gutters, a job which can be extremely time-consuming and sometimes dangerous. Neglecting the upkeep of your gutters, however, can lead to even greater problems later on. Clogged gutters can overflow, encouraging mildew and mold growth and causing runoff damage to your home and yard. An untouched gutter can be an appealing home for bees and birds, and a debris-filled gutter may attract roaches.

The first and most obvious benefit is that adding gutter guards to your home reduces the need for gutter cleaning. Although there is nothing that can eliminate the need for gutter cleaning, adding gutter guards greatly reduces the amount of time you (or your local gutter service professionals) will need to spend on a ladder.
Some other benefits of gutter guards include keeping pests away — including bees and birds that nest in gutters, in addition to roaches and other insects that are attracted to gutter debris — and reducing the chance of water damage to your home and property. Unobstructed, free-flowing gutters are also less likely to rust and corrode prematurely, saving you money on repair and replacement.
Gutter guards can be divided into six main types, with varying levels of installation difficulty. Foam and brush guards are simpler to install on your own; mesh and screen guards take more work and should be installed by a professional; and surface tension and micro-mesh guards require professional installation.

The final cost of gutter guard installation in Parkland fluctuates based on a number of factors, including the size of your home and the ease of accessing your gutter system. The style of gutter guards you choose will also affect the price, as the cost per linear foot is decided by material type. Another thing that will affect the cost is whether you install the gutter guards on your own, use the services of a local contractor in Parkland, or hire one of the full-service gutter guard installation companies that operates in Florida. Taking care of the job yourself is the least expensive option. Hiring a full-service company will be the most expensive but will also offer the most support when it comes to jobs like picking a material and measuring your gutters.

Gutter guard material | Cost per foot of material | Cost for typical home | Total cost including labor |
---|---|---|---|
Brush | $4.52 - $12.34 | $1130-$3085 | $2,657 - $4,612 |
Foam | $1.92 - $3.52 | $480-$880 | $2,007 - $2,407 |
Screen | $0.38 - $1.38 | $95-$345 | $1,622 - $1,872 |
Mesh | $0.82 - $2.7 | $205 - $687 | $1,732 - $2,214 |
Micro-mesh | $1.69 - $2.32 | $244 - $580 | $1,771 - $2,107 |
Surface tension | $1.08 - $1.55 | $270 - $387 | $1,797 - $1,914 |

If you need to verify the trustworthiness of a gutter guard installation company, a good place to begin is by looking at online reviews, including on the BBB website. When you connect with one of Parkland's gutter guard installation companies, they should be able to provide, following their inspection, a written estimate and information about their warranties. A trustworthy company should have insurance, in case a worker sustains an injury on your property, and they should provide you information about how the work to be done will or will not affect your roof warranty.
